Subject: Re: Development of ICC Lite
In reply to: John 's message, "Development of ICC Lite" on 09:44:44 10/13/04 Wed

Identity and philosophical differences: The ICOC name is a useful handle to describe who we are and what we are about. One-another relationships and a commitment to evangelism are what make us distinct.

Hey, that's the same as in UBF. They say that "1:1 bible study" and "absolute obedience to Jesus’ world mission command" and "spiritual order" (code word for authoritarism) is the UBF "tradition" or the "spiritual heritage." And because of this tradition, they believe to be the only "real" Christians in the world. They expelled the reformers not for Biblical reasons, but because they allegedly left the "UBF tradition."

By the way, "One-another relationships" has become the new code word for discipleship partners. It's like no one can let go of the discipling ministry that created this mess, so they come up with a euphemism for discipling.

Didn't ICC already change the word "discipler" to "discipleship partner" in order to conceal the hierarchical aspect of the relation?

This is explained by saying that we still need to fulfill the "one another" passages

What where these "one another" passages? In UBF, they used the passages that spoke about shepherds. They did not care whether these passages spoke about Jesus, the good shepherd, or whether they spoke about elders, overseeing the whole flock. They just misapplied these passages to their paradigm of "1:1 shepherds" without caring to give justification for 1:1 from the Bible.
